GML
9500

The 9500 is the mastering version of the 8200.
This IS the best analog EQ of all time, and perhaps the EQ of any
type, analog or digital.
Dual-mono in operation requiring two outboard 8355 power supplies,
it includes fully detented controls for absolute precision and repeatability.
It features 1/2db steps of boost and cut, and 24 frequency choices
per band. It is a powerful EQ, one that has made the difference
to countless mastering engineers and become a legendary device.

GML 2030 Mastering Dynamic Gain Control

The Model 2030 Mastering Dynamic Gain Control is a precise tool for mastering
and other critical applications where the utmost in control, flexibility, and
transparency is demanded. Based on the proven GML Series III control and audio
architecture, this no-compromise dynamic range controller continues the GML
engineering tradition and expands familiar Model 8900 capabilities, including
multi-channel operation.

The S3 all tube multiband compressor!
The new S3 Stereo Three Band Optical Compressor incorporates
the very latest in Ivor Drawmer designs and the aim from the very beginning
was to create a ‘no technical compromise’ circuit using only
the highest grade components. The S3 forms the basis of a ‘Signature
Series’ and offers previously unattainable control and tonality
over each of the three bands - gain control at each stage provides precise
spectral balancing.
THREE-SUM Multiband
Interface/ Summing device

CLICK
HERE FOR LARGER PICTURE
The
benefits of multi-band processing,
with the ability to apply different
parameters to different sections
of the audio bandwidth have
been apparent to sound engineers for
quite some time. However, ‘locking
in’ your audio to any
one specific multi-band unit
can
vastly reduce
the creative options. The desired
combination of processing to
deal with low frequency energy,
the vocal
mid range and high frequency
detail and enhancement is not
necessarily
available from any one manufacturer.
The Drawmer THREE-SUM opens up a whole
new set of options allowing the
engineer to split the audio into
two or three bands and apply his
or her own sonic signature to each
part of the audio bandwidth.
